Is Forza Motorsport 6 Still Available?
The simple answer is no, Forza Motorsport 6 is no longer available for purchase digitally. It reached its “end of life” status on September 15, 2019, meaning it was removed from the Xbox Store and is no longer sold.

The “End of Life” Explained: Why Forza Motorsport 6 Was Delisted
The delisting of Forza Motorsport 6, like many other Forza titles before and since, is a common practice in the gaming industry due primarily to licensing agreements. These agreements, which cover everything from car models and manufacturers to in-game music and track designs, are typically time-limited. Renewing these licenses can be expensive and may not always be feasible or cost-effective for the game developers and publishers, especially as newer titles in the franchise are released.
Once the licenses expire, the game can no longer be legally sold digitally. This prevents potential copyright infringement and ensures that Turn 10 Studios and Microsoft remain compliant with the agreements they have in place. Can You Still Play Forza Motorsport 6 If You Own It?
The good news is that if you previously purchased Forza Motorsport 6 digitally or own a physical copy, you can still play the game. The servers may be less populated than they once were, but the core gameplay experience remains intact.
- Digital Owners: You can re-download the game from your Xbox account library as long as you have sufficient storage space.
- Physical Owners: Simply insert the disc into your Xbox One or Xbox Series X/S console (if it has a disc drive) and install the game.
What About DLC?
Unfortunately, similar to the base game, DLC for Forza Motorsport 6 is no longer available for purchase through the Xbox Store. If you previously purchased DLC, you should still be able to access it and download it as long as you have the base game installed. However, if you never bought the DLC, there is no legitimate way to acquire it now.

The Legacy of Forza Motorsport 6
Despite its delisting, Forza Motorsport 6 remains a beloved entry in the franchise. It was praised for its stunning graphics, extensive car list, and challenging gameplay. It introduced innovative features like night racing and wet weather conditions, which significantly enhanced the realism and immersion of the game. Why was Forza Motorsport 6 removed from the Xbox Store? Forza Motorsport 6 was removed due to expiring licensing agreements related to car manufacturers, music, and track designs. Renewing these licenses becomes less viable as newer titles are released.
-
Can I still buy a physical copy of Forza Motorsport 6? Yes, you can often find used physical copies of Forza Motorsport 6 at retailers like GameStop, online marketplaces like eBay and Amazon, and from private sellers. However, prices may vary depending on the condition and availability of the game.

Is Forza Motorsport 6 backward compatible on newer Xbox consoles? Yes, Forza Motorsport 6 is backward compatible and can be played on Xbox One, Xbox One S, Xbox One X, Xbox Series X, and Xbox Series S consoles.
-
What happens if I delete Forza Motorsport 6 from my Xbox after purchasing it digitally? You can re-download Forza Motorsport 6 from your Xbox account library at any time, as long as you originally purchased it digitally.
-
Can I transfer my save data from Forza Motorsport 6 to a newer Forza game? No, save data cannot be directly transferred between different Forza games. Each game has its own separate save system.

If I have Forza Motorsport 6 on disc, do I need an internet connection to play? You do not need a constant internet connection to play the single-player campaign or local multiplayer modes. However, an internet connection is required to download updates, access online features, and upload lap times to leaderboards.
